AVP, Underwriting Director- Core Contract Surety Zurich Insurance is currently looking for an

Executive Underwriter OR AVP, Underwriting Director– Core Contract Northeast Region Surety Division.

This is a highly technical and market‑facing position and requires experience with Surety lines of business. This position will be located in Boston, Massachusetts, and other locations may be considered for the right candidate. The role requires approximately 20% travel.

This role will be filled at either the Executive Underwriter or AVP, Underwriting Director level. The hiring manager will determine the appropriate level based upon the selected applicant’s experience and skill set relative to the qualifications listed for this position.

As a member of Zurich’s Surety Underwriting Team, you will have the opportunity to fully apply and hone your underwriting and marketing skills. Specifically, you will underwrite and analyze new and renewal Surety business utilizing The Zurich Way of Underwriting Framework within delegated authority levels on assignments of higher technical complexity, ensuring a high‑level service to customers. Our underwriters are client‑externally focused, and the job’s core deliverables rely on delivering exceptional service to external clients and/or customers. The role typically involves building relationships and promoting the company.

Responsibilities

Production and underwriting of new and renewal Surety business

Handling of a large book of prominent accounts

Internal marketing and production within Zurich North America in support of our cross‑sell efforts

Execution of the external marketing strategy

Adherence to underwriting rules and guidelines, insurance laws, regulations, and the Zurich Way of underwriting

Establish new and develop existing agency and broker relationships

Working within limits and authorities on assignments of varying degrees of complexity

Executive Underwriter Qualifications

High School Diploma or equivalent and 5 or more years of experience in the Underwriting or Market Facing, Finance, Accounting, or Banking area

High School Diploma or equivalent and 10 or more years of experience in the Claims or Underwriting Support area

Zurich Certified Apprentice program including an associate degree and 3 or more years of experience in the Underwriting or Market Facing, Finance, Accounting, or Banking area

Zurich Certified Apprentice program including an associate degree and 8 or more years of experience in the Claims or Underwriting Support area

Knowledge of Microsoft Office

Experience working on time restraints for quotes on new and renewal business

Experience working in a team environment

AVP, Underwriting Director Qualifications

High School Diploma or equivalent and 7 or more years of experience in the Underwriting or Market Facing, Finance, Accounting, or Banking area

High School Diploma or equivalent and 14 or more years of experience in the Claims or Underwriting Support area

Zurich Certified Insurance Apprentice including an associate degree and 5 or more years of experience in the Underwriting or Market Facing, Finance, Accounting, or Banking area

Zurich Certified Insurance Apprentice including an associate degree and 12 or more years of experience in the Claims or Underwriting Support area

Experience with Microsoft Office

Preferred Qualifications

Bachelor’s Degree

In‑depth knowledge of Surety lines of business and the legal and regulatory guidelines

Ability to effectively assess risk

Strong negotiation skills

Strong broker relationships

Superior skills in relationship building, active listening, needs analysis, and win‑win negotiation

Possess a high level of customer service by meeting or exceeding broker and/or customer expectations with respect to required deadlines

Excellent oral and written communication skills

Strong knowledge of underwriting philosophy, techniques, national/local filing regulations and guidelines

The compensation indicated represents a nationwide market range and has not been adjusted for geographic differentials pertaining to the location where the position may be filled. The combined salary range for this position is $98,500.00 – $215,000.00. The proposed salary range for the Executive Underwriter is $98,500.00 – $165,000.00, with short‑term incentive bonus eligibility set at 15%. For the AVP, Underwriting Director is $130,000.00 – $215,000.00, with short‑term incentive bonus eligibility set at 20%.
